Toothache can strike at any time of year, but summer brings its own set of triggers. Cold drinks, ice cream, and chilled foods can aggravate sensitivity and underlying dental concerns, leaving patients in sudden and unexpected discomfort.

If toothache strikes, recommend Orajel® for fast and effective pain relief. The proven solution gets to work in just 2 minutes,[i] allowing your patients to get back to whatever they were doing.

Two versions are available: Orajel® Dental Gel contains 10% benzocaine,[ii] which is an anaesthetic that reduces pain associated with common dental concerns, like a broken tooth that might require a filling. If patients are experiencing more acute dental pain, the Orajel® Extra Strength containing 20% benzocaine may be more appropriate,[iii] offering greater relief with a similar fast-action mechanism.
